Gathering Evidence of Negligence to Prove Claim

When filing a claim for a truck accident in Los Angeles, an insurance company may dispute your claim for several reasons, even if you were not at fault. For example, an insurance adjuster may argue that your injuries are not as severe as you claim or that you did not take reasonable steps to minimize damages. To avoid or overcome these disputes, providing substantial evidence to support your claim is essential.

Our Los Angeles truck accident attorneys at Fiore Legal will promptly investigate to collect the necessary evidence for your case. It is essential to act quickly, as valuable evidence can become unavailable or altered over time. This is particularly true for truck accidents, where the electronic data recorder or black box can be tampered with. Other common types of evidence include the following:

  • Police report
  • Black box data
  • Vehicle inspection and maintenance reports
  • Trucking company’s employment records
  • Driver’s logbooks
  • Bills of lading
  • Electronic data logs
  • Photos and videos 
  • Forensic evidence from the crash site 
  • An account of the accident from reconstruction experts

Steps to Take After a Truck Accident in Los Angeles

If you are involved in a truck accident, staying calm and gathering any physical evidence you can find is essential. This includes taking photographs and videos of the scene, obtaining the truck driver's information, and collecting contact details of potential eyewitnesses. It is also crucial to report the accident to the police. Do not ignore any injuries you may have sustained; seek medical attention at the nearest emergency room immediately. Afterward, you should speak with our experienced truck accident lawyers in Los Angeles and file a claim with your insurance company.

When filing an insurance claim, an adjuster will review your case and determine your eligibility for benefits. It is essential to be cautious when communicating with the adjuster. Please do not agree to any recorded or written statements during conversations. Do not sign medical release forms or enter into direct claim negotiations without first speaking with our attorneys. California Statute of Limitations for Truck Accidents

To ensure you do not miss the deadline for filing a claim, it is crucial to act promptly and bring your case on time. Typically, accident victims have two years from the accident date to file an injury claim. Failing to file a lawsuit within this time limit may result in the court throwing out your claim. However, waiting until you have achieved maximum medical improvement (MMI) before accepting any settlement offers is critical.
